TERRY RUTHERFORD
Port Moody, BC


Terry is a book conservator in private practice since 1986. She studied traditional hand bookbinding in the UK, and book conservation at the Centro del bel libro, Ascona, Switzerland. She studied parchment manuscript restoration and worked as a book conservator in Switzerland in 1994 and 1995. Terry returned to study fine binding and alternative book structures at the Centro del bel libro in 2001. Terry teaches traditional and non-traditional bookbinding structures in classes and as a private tutor.
